Discover the fascinating world of second language acquisition with "Second Language Learning" by Michael Sharwood Smith, published by Taylor & Francis Ltd in 2016. This comprehensive volume spans 260 pages and offers a meticulous survey and analysis of contemporary theories in second language studies.
Michael Sharwood Smith delves into the evolution of ideas in this dynamic field, unpacking their implications for both learners and educators. The book not only provides a rich theoretical framework but also includes valuable study questions and practical activities to enhance understanding and engagement. Readers will find useful guidelines for navigating available research resources, making it an essential tool for anyone interested in second language learning and pedagogy.
